Iceland - Male Tertiary Enrolment in Engineering Manufacturing and Construction
Since 2014, Iceland Male Tertiary Enrolment in Engineering Manufacturing and Construction decreased by 4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 38 comparing other countries in Male Tertiary Enrolment in Engineering Manufacturing and Construction with 977 Persons. Iceland is overtaken by Estonia, which was number 37 at 5,308 Persons and is followed by Luxembourg at 536 Persons. Russia topped the ranking with 1,257,227 Persons in 2019, that is a decrease of 1.8% versus 2018. United States, Brazil and Mexico resp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. United Kingdom recorded the best 5 years average growth at +38.6% per year, while Slovakia witnessed the worst performance at -6.7% per year.
